Output ac80762603a3a0bf8384c1b3aae84a56d52a5f4206bb741aed2efe29ab201e8d:13

value
23032011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a3306bfde8ff642e3d1db6afcb6655b736ff308 OP_EQUAL
address
M8q67irkB8iDXe6cjx51m9v8fxUA7oJah8
transaction
ac80762603a3a0bf8384c1b3aae84a56d52a5f4206bb741aed2efe29ab201e8d
spent
true